Northwest Wreaths make decorative wreaths, garland and centerpieces from beautiful mountain evergreens straight from Shelton, Washington. All greens are sustainably harvested to keep Washington state green.

northwest wreaths holiday garland

I loved this Northwest Wreath Western Red Cedar Garland (15′).  I had always wanted a garland around the front door but never got around to hanging one. You can use this for decorating a doorway, banister, archway or window inside or out. Western Red Cedar is known for its fresh aroma and color, it was so fun to hang and drink in all that scent.

northwest wreaths holiday fresh wreath

I have always had a fake wreath on my front door for the holidays. What a treat to have my guests welcomed by the Countryside Wreath (24″). This Noble Fir wreath includes fresh salal, incense cedar, huckleberry, red apples, berries and ponderosa pinecones. It’s so pretty I might just wear it for a holiday scarf! Or maybe the garland?
